How they compare
Malta currently reports 18.02 against 17.94 in Antigua and Barbuda, a difference of 0.08.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 7 shared years of data; in 2018 it was Antigua and Barbuda ahead.
Antigua and Barbuda ranks 130th and Malta ranks 129th of 172 countries.
Antigua and Barbuda has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

About this data
The weights are meant to reflect the relative importance of the goods and services as measured by their shares in the total consumption of households. Data are disaggregated by the Classification of Individual Consumption According to Purpose (COICOP). For more information, refer to the Prices, Costs, and Currency Conversions (PRICES) database description.
